The most economically damaging cyberattack in UK history was Jaguar Land Rover: £1.9 billion, five weeks of halted production, 5,000+ organisations hit.† It cascaded through the supply chain before surfacing in any threat feed. It runs the other way too: as Red Sea shipping was rerouted, maritime analysts logged a parallel rise in port and vessel-tracking system targeting — the geopolitical shift arrived before the intrusion. The entire platform is built on that pattern.
† Cyber Monitoring Centre, October 2025
